Familia: Pelodytidae
Genus: Pelodytes
Species: Pelodytes caucasicus
Name
Pelodytes caucasicus Boulenger, 1896
Type locality: "Mount Lomis, Caucasus, 7000 feet", near Bakuriani, Georgia.
Holotype: BM.
